内容简介:
本书上篇全面回顾了我国综合评价理论研究的思想方法历史,总结了综合评价的八大要素体系,并依此构建综合评价研究框架。着重讨论了综合评价三大基础理论—指标处理理论、权数理论与集成理论。本书下篇总结团队近年来的**研究成果,重点研究了BoD权数的构造、主客体分组情形下的群组评价,以及区间信息、模糊信息与函数型数据的综合评价前沿理论问题。撰写过程中突出了理论方法的基础性与通用性,实践应用的简捷性与规范性,在相关理论问题的探讨中,试图融合统计学、管理决策、系统学科等领域的思想方法,以期推进综合评价学界共同学术话语体系的达成。
